The beauty of our Christmas Program is the way it touches the lives of those who serve with us too… even people from around the globe. Here’s an email we recently received from Joe O’Connor from New Zealand. He was in Massachusetts last year coaching field hockey at Holy Cross.

Hi Guys! Not sure if you will remember a New Zealand field hockey coach called Joe, but that’s me! I helped out a little bit last year at the Keeper in Easton around early-mid December with the Christmas deliveries!

I’m back home now that my time in the States is over, and I suddenly realized that after all this time I had never got in touch to say what amazing work you guys do. Honestly it was an incredible experience to be a part of, even for just a week or so. The difference you make in other’s lives is genuinely heartwarming. Seeing the faces of the kids when we delivered their Christmas parcels, and even more so, the faces and gratitude of the mothers and fathers was something I’ve never really experienced before, and it showed the difference a person can make in someone’s life with a few presents, a song, a hug and a smile.

There were too many amazing people I met to name, but guys like Erich and Ryan who ran things so smoothly and calmly, John who encouraged us to sing (haha!), Andrew who is roughly the same age as me but is doing so much good work, and Vin who was the first person who greeted me when I arrived and I had no idea what I was doing! All these people, and everyone else I met, what you are doing is something truly special. Thanks for making me feel so welcome!

Thanks for letting me be a part of the tremendous work you guys do. I hope someday I can find a way to help people the way you all do! God bless and hope you are all well!
